金陵学院:《计算机应用》课程教学资源(PPT课件)第四章 数据类型和输入输出

计算机应用 Computer Application 第四章数据类型和输入输出 陵学院2005.10~200511 袁杰yuanjie@nju.edu.cn
计算机应用 Computer Application 第四章 数据类型和输入输出 金陵学院 2005.10~2005.11 袁杰 yuanjie@nju.edu.cn

本章作业和要求 3.1(用 sprint显示结果,并将结果存储到文 件gold.mat中) 使用help命令了解 strmatch函数和sep函 数的具体用法并各举一例 重点和要点:熟练掌握各类数据类型和运 算,字符串和数据的显示方法以及数据文 件的输入和输出,熟悉涉及到的函数 注意:本章内容书上不全,请做好笔记 考核方式:书面考核和上机考核
本章作业和要求 3.1 (用sprintf显示结果,并将结果存储到文 件gold.mat中) 使用 help 命令了解strmatch函数和strrep函 数的具体用法并各举一例 重点和要点:熟练掌握各类数据类型和运 算,字符串和数据的显示方法以及数据文 件的输入和输出,熟悉涉及到的函数 注意:本章内容书上不全,请做好笔记 考核方式:书面考核和上机考核

Matlab数据类型 Matlab数据类型 基本数据类型字符串逻辑类型结构元胞数组其他类型 logical 双精度类型 double 函数句柄 单精度类型inge 内嵌对象 整数类型 Java对象 8位 16位32位 64位 int8 int16 int32 int64 uint8 uint16 uint32 uint64
Matlab数据类型 Matlab数据类型 基本数据类型 字符串 逻辑类型 logical 结构 元胞数组 其他类型 双精度类型double 单精度类型single 整数类型 8位 int8 uint8 16位 int16 uint16 64位 int64 uint64 32位 int32 uint32 函数句柄 内嵌对象 Java对象

Matlab数据运算 class函数:查看数据类型 ◎默认的运算都是针对 double类型的数据 ·2进制,10进制,16进制以及相互转换 整数类型的数据运算函数,移位运算 bitand, bitcmp, bitor, bitxor, bitshift 逻辑类型数据True(), False( 逻辑运算&,|,~ 关系运算==,~=,,>=,<=
Matlab数据运算 class 函数:查看数据类型 默认的运算都是针对double类型的数据 2进制,10进制,16进制以及相互转换 整数类型的数据运算函数,移位运算 bitand, bitcmp, bitor, bitxor, bitshift 逻辑类型数据 True(1), False(0) 逻辑运算 &, |, ~ 关系运算 ==, ~=, , >=, <=

Matlab运算优先级 1.括号(,点 2.转置,幂八 3.负号-,逻辑非 4.乘法,除法 5.加法+,减法 6.冒号 7.关系运算,,,,, 8.与,或
Matlab运算优先级 1. 括号 (),点. 2. 转置 ’,幂 ^ 3. 负号 -,逻辑非 ~ 4. 乘法 *,除法 / 5. 加法 +,减法 - 6. 冒号 : 7. 关系运算 > , = , <= 8. 与 &,或 |

Matlab中的字符串 字符串的表达S= matlab is a tool 子字符串(类似子矩阵) ·字符串的操作 strcat, strcmp, strncmp, strcmpi, strncmpi ·数字和字符之间的转换 num2st(画图),int2st,str2 double,str2num 不同数值类型之间的转换 hex2dec, deczhex, bin2dec. dec2bin
Matlab中的字符串 字符串的表达 s=‘matlab is a tool’ 子字符串(类似子矩阵) 字符串的操作 strcat, strcmp, strncmp, strcmpi, strncmpi 数字和字符之间的转换 num2str(画图), int2str, str2double, str2num 不同数值类型之间的转换 hex2dec, dec2hex, bin2dec, dec2bin

格式化输入输出 dsp函数 sprint数 %c,%d,%e,%E,%,%s,%X,%X input函数(标量,向量,矩阵和字符串) 10ad函数,load文件名(mat) save函数,save文件名(mat)变量列表 默认文件扩展名为,rat
格式化输入输出 disp函数 sprintf函数 %c, %d, %e, %E, %f, %s, %x, %X input函数(标量,向量,矩阵和字符串) load函数,load 文件名(.mat) save函数,save 文件名(.mat) 变量列表 默认文件扩展名为 .mat

第四章到此结束
第四章到此结束

Back 夏 ATLAH 包回囟 Eile Edit Debug Desktop Window Help Comand Window N Bytes Class 96 double array 1x16 32 char array Grand total is 28 elements using 128 bytes >> save Saving to: matlab. mat > clear > whos 72? Undefined function or variableA >>10ad Loading from: matlab. mat Current Directory Command History Command Window
Back

Back 夏 AILAB Eile Edit Debug Desktop Window Hell Comand Lindow >A=[1234;5678;9630] 4 159 266 373 > save nanjing A > clear > load nanjing. mat 159 266 373 4 Current Directory Command HistoryCommand Window sTart
Back
按次数下载不扣除下载券;
注册用户24小时内重复下载只扣除一次;
顺序:VIP每日次数-->可用次数-->下载券;
- 金陵学院:《计算机应用》课程教学资源(PPT课件)第三章 矩阵和Matlab(主讲:袁杰).ppt
- 金陵学院:《计算机应用》课程教学资源(PPT课件)第二章 Matlab基本知识.ppt
- 《Visual Basic6.0程序设计》绪论.ppt
- 《Visual Basic6.0程序设计》第五章 对话框与菜单.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第四章 窗体及常用控件.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第三章 VB语言程序设计基础.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第三章 VB语言程序设计基础.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第六章 过程、模块与类.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第二章 中文Visual Basic(VB)6.0概述.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第五章 对话框与菜单.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第七章 常用算法.ppt
- 《Visual Basic 6.0程序设计》课程电子教案(PPT教学课件)第一章 程序设计概述.ppt
- 万博科技职业学院:《Visual Basic程序设计》讲义.ppt
- 《Excel 2003讲义》第五章 电子表格中文Excel 2003.ppt
- 《VFP应用实例》应用实例.ppt
- 《数字平面艺术设计》课程教学资源(教材PPT课件,图片版)第1章 视觉传达原理与平面设计基础知识.ppt
- 《机械人技术》讲义.pdf
- 《CFX5.5培训资料》(英文版)Solver Control.ppt
- 《CFX5.5培训资料》(英文版)Mesh.ppt
- 《CFX5.5培训资料》(英文版)Introduction.ppt
- 金陵学院:《计算机应用》课程教学资源(PPT课件)第五章 Matlab绘图.ppt
- 金陵学院:《计算机应用》课程教学资源(PPT课件)第六章 Matlab程序.ppt
- 国防科学技术大学:《数理逻辑》课程考试模拟试卷.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 1 Preliminaries.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 2 Propositional Calculus.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 3 Propositional Calculus(Cont’d).p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 4 Propositional Calculus(Cont’d).p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 5 Predicate Calculus.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 6 Reasoning in Predicate Calculus.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 7 Prenex Normal Form.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 8 Semantics.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 9 Independence.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 10 Completenss.pdf
- 国防科学技术大学:《数理逻辑》(英文版)Lecture 11 Syntax.pdf
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第7章 防火墙(李艇).ppt
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第1章 网络管理概述(李艇).ppt
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第2章 管理信息结构与管理信息库(李艇).ppt
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第3章 SNMP通信模型与RMON规范(李艇).ppt
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第4章 网络管理系统(李艇).ppt
- 《计算机网络管理与安全技术》课程教学资源(PPT课件)第5章 网络安全基础(李艇).ppt